Ticket: Config drift — Shorepane tide-table widget

The prod Shorepane widget is fetching tide data from the retired upstream endpoint while staging uses the new signed feed. Drift appeared after the emergency rollback two weeks ago; nobody re-applied the follow-up change. Requesting security review of the current prod values before we force-sync, since the old feed skips signature checks. Current prod configuration follows.

deployment values, fahap-hahaf:
[casdor]
port = 9200
region = south-2
host = casdor.qirvanworks.corp
timeout_ms = 3000
retries = 4

Vendored Fonts — Quick Note

All third-party fonts used in the Larkspur design system are vendored under assets/fonts, never fetched at runtime. Before adding a typeface, confirm its license permits redistribution and record it in LICENSES.md. Our contract with Glyphholt Type covers the Merrow family only. For licensing questions, reach the vendor desk here.

pager mailbox: silael.sorwyn.tamius@zemvarsys.corp

**Vendor note: Inkmill markdown pipeline**

Rendering for Parchway docs is outsourced to Inkmill under an annual contract, renewing each March. They handle sanitization and PDF export; we own the upload queue. SLA: 4-hour response on rendering failures. Escalate only after two failed retries. Their support desk is reachable at the address below.

billing contact of hahaf-baguf = zorael.tammir.jorius@sivrelhq.internal

Onboarding note for the Ledgerpane admin table: bulk edits are applied through the batcher service, not directly against the database. Select rows, choose an action, and the batcher stages changes in a pending set you can review before commit. Edits over 500 rows require a second approver — this is enforced server-side, so don't try to chunk around it. To run the batcher locally you need the staging write credential, which goes in your .env as the next line.

secret setting of bahip-kagag: RELAY_SECRET3=c83